The BMW repair market in Warren, Michigan, is highly competitive and of above-average quality, benefiting from the region's deep-rooted automotive industry expertise. The presence of numerous independent specialists provides BMW owners with robust alternatives to dealerships, typically at a 30-50% cost savings for labor and parts. Competition is strong, which drives a focus on customer service and technical specialization. Shops that survive and thrive here typically have technicians with formal BMW training or extensive dealer experience. Pricing is generally in line with the metro Detroit area, with standard diagnostic fees ranging from $150-$200 and labor rates between $120-$170 per hour. The high concentration of performance and M-series vehicles in the area means that top shops are well-versed in high-performance tuning and brake systems.

Common questions about bmw repair services in Warren, MI
In Warren, we frequently address suspension and steering component wear from potholes and rough roads, as well as battery and electrical issues exacerbated by Michigan's extreme temperature swings. Cooling system failures are also common, especially with older models, due to the stress of both summer heat and winter cold.
Look for shops that are BMW-specific or European-specialist, and verify their technicians are ASE-certified or have BMW factory training. In Warren, shops like those on Mound Road or near the GM Tech Center often have strong reputations; always check for detailed online reviews and ask for referrals from local BMW clubs.
You should seek diagnosis immediately, as a check engine light can indicate issues critical to the complex emissions systems required to pass Michigan's annual vehicle inspections. Prompt service can prevent minor sensor faults, common in older BMWs, from escalating into costly damage to the catalytic converter.
Yes, BMW repairs are typically more expensive due to specialized parts and labor. For common services in Warren, expect to pay $150-$250 for an oil change with synthetic oil, $400-$800 for brake pad and rotor replacement, and $1,000+ for major repairs like valve cover gaskets or cooling system overhauls.
Given Michigan's harsh winters with heavy road salt, undercarriage washes are crucial to prevent rust and corrosion. We also recommend more frequent inspections of suspension components due to poor road conditions and ensuring your battery is tested before winter, as cold weather places a high demand on BMW's electrical systems.
